摘要
The reduction of 2-nitrophenylacetic acids to oxindoles promoted by SmI2 is reported for the first time. This reaction involving the reduction of nitro group proceeds through N-O bond cleavage and direct condensation with the neighboring carboxyl group. From a synthetic point of view, a new method for the synthesis of oxindoles in mild neutral conditions is developed.
